The Conversion Process: 100,900 Meters to Kilometers

The conversion from meters to kilometers is a simple division problem because one kilometer equals 1000 meters. Which means, to convert meters to kilometers, we divide the number of meters by 1000 And that's really what it comes down to..

Step 1: Identify the conversion factor.

The conversion factor from meters to kilometers is 1 km = 1000 m. So in practice, 1 kilometer is equal to 1000 meters Most people skip this — try not to..

Step 2: Set up the conversion.

We have 100,900 meters and we want to convert it to kilometers. We can set up the conversion as follows:

100,900 m × (1 km / 1000 m)

Notice that we multiply the number of meters by a fraction (1 km / 1000 m). This fraction is equal to 1 because the numerator and denominator represent the same distance. Multiplying by a fraction equal to 1 doesn't change the value, only the units.

Step 3: Perform the calculation.

The 'm' (meters) units cancel each other out, leaving only 'km' (kilometers). The calculation is:

100,900 / 1000 = 100.9

Step 4: State the result.

That's why, 100,900 meters is equal to 100.9 kilometers Simple, but easy to overlook..

Practical Applications of Meter-Kilometer Conversions

Converting meters to kilometers (or vice versa) has numerous practical applications across various fields:

  • Mapping and Geography: Distances on maps are often represented in kilometers, while smaller details might use meters. Converting between these units is crucial for accurate calculations of distances and areas.

  • Civil Engineering: In construction projects, measurements of distances, lengths of roads, or the dimensions of buildings are typically done in meters. Even so, project plans and overall layouts often use kilometers to represent larger distances.

  • Sports and Athletics: Many running and cycling events use kilometers to measure race distances. Understanding the conversion allows for easy comparison between races measured in meters and kilometers Took long enough..

  • Travel and Navigation: GPS systems and mapping apps often provide distances in both kilometers and miles, depending on user preferences and regional settings. Conversion knowledge is helpful for interpreting these distances effectively Less friction, more output..

  • Scientific Research: Many scientific experiments and measurements involve lengths and distances. Converting units is essential for consistency and proper interpretation of results.

Frequently Asked Questions (FAQ)

Q1: How do I convert kilometers back to meters?

To convert kilometers to meters, you multiply the number of kilometers by 1000. Because of that, for example, 100. 9 km * 1000 m/km = 100,900 m.

Q2: Can I use online converters for this type of conversion?

Yes, numerous online unit converters are available that can perform this conversion instantly. Still, understanding the underlying process is crucial for developing a strong grasp of unit conversions and problem-solving skills.

Q3: What if I need to convert meters to other units of length, like centimeters or millimeters?

The same principle applies. Still, you need to know the conversion factors: 1 meter = 100 centimeters and 1 meter = 1000 millimeters. You can then set up similar conversion factors as shown above and perform the calculations But it adds up..

Q4: Are there any common mistakes to avoid when converting units?

One common mistake is using the wrong conversion factor or forgetting to multiply or divide correctly. Carefully check your work and ensure you're using the correct conversion factor. Always double-check your units to make sure they cancel out properly.
